Transaction 5364b307096749013646ef2b94c4c80f28414b250afb457c5900ac0cc3606a46

1 Input
2 Outputs
  • 5364b307096749013646ef2b94c4c80f28414b250afb457c5900ac0cc3606a46:0
  • value  2430000
    address  1NszPKoJR2NCoFMkXHFbhrrT19VLR3T98o
  • 5364b307096749013646ef2b94c4c80f28414b250afb457c5900ac0cc3606a46:1
  • value  21322754
    address  17DpVR41pvLwhyL2XwvpFEMQPHf1XyfE5i